Business Context and Reporting Period
Company: PolyOne Corporation (Note: Filing header lists "AVIENT CORP" in metadata, but document text confirms "PolyOne Corporation").
Filing Type: Form 10-Q (Quarterly Report)
Period Ended: September 30, 2008
Business Overview: A global provider of specialized polymer materials, services, and solutions. The company operates in six segments: International Color and Engineered Materials, Specialty Engineered Materials, Specialty Color, Additives and Inks, Performance Products and Solutions, PolyOne Distribution, and Resin and Intermediates.
Key Events: Acquired GLS Corporation in January 2008 ($148.9M); announced restructuring of manufacturing assets in July 2008; reorganized operating segments in Q2 2008.

Material Changes vs. Prior Period
- Revenue Growth: Sales increased 10.6% in Q3 and 9.2% for the nine-month period. The GLS acquisition contributed 5.6 percentage points to Q3 growth. Foreign exchange and PolyOne Distribution growth accounted for the remainder.
- Operating Income Improvement: Operating income improved significantly from a loss of $23.6M in Q3 2007 to a profit of $1.3M in Q3 2008. This was driven by lower environmental remediation charges ($19.6M favorable variance) and a $15.6M reimbursement from Goodrich Corporation, partially offset by higher restructuring charges.
- Net Income Volatility: Q3 2008 net loss of $5.6M contrasts with Q3 2007 net income of $2.3M. The 2007 result included a one-time $31.5M tax benefit from the reversal of deferred tax liabilities related to the sale of an equity affiliate (OxyVinyls), which did not recur in 2008.
- Segment Performance:
- Performance Products & Solutions: Operating income declined 57.9% due to weak demand in North American residential construction and automotive markets.
- Specialty Engineered Materials: Operating income improved significantly due to the inclusion of GLS.
- PolyOne Distribution: Operating income increased 77.4% driven by a more profitable sales mix.
- Restructuring: Announced a $31M one-time charge for manufacturing realignment (closing 8 facilities, reducing ~150 jobs). $11.6M was recognized in Q3 2008.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
- Outlook Revision: Management lowered earnings expectations for the full year. Q4 earnings may fall short of previous expectations due to the global economic slowdown, weakening Euro, and supply/pricing uncertainties from Gulf storms (Hurricanes Gustav and Ike).
- Capital Expenditures: Forecast reduced to less than $55M for the year (previously $55M-$60M) to preserve liquidity.
- Liquidity Strategy: Prioritizing free cash flow for short-term debt repayments and working capital requirements over additional capital expenditures or debt reduction.
- Key Risks:
- Economic Downturn: Significant strain on end markets including housing, construction, automotive, and electronics.
- Raw Materials: Rising costs and supply constraints.
- Credit Markets: Volatility may limit access to capital or increase borrowing costs.
- Environmental: Potential for additional costs related to remediation of inactive sites beyond current accruals ($89.8M).
